word complicate
sentence I have every reason to believe that we shall be in time to stop it. But to-day being Saturday rather complicates matters.
definition [verb]
1. (transitive) To make complex; to modify so as to make something intricate or difficult.
2. (transitive) To involve in a convoluted matter.
[adjective]
1. (obsolete) Intertwined.
2. (now rare, poetic) Complex, complicated.
